India’s record of victory in the Holkar stadium is 100%
Talking about the Holkar stadium of Indore, it has always been kind to the Indian team. Here India has won all the matches. In the current series between India and Australia, India has won the toss in both matches and interestingly, India has not lost any toss till date at the Holkar stadium. Obviously, in such a way, the Indian team would like to retain the record of winning 100% of their matches on this ground.
Holkar stadium is a clinic to treat bad form
In the Holkar stadium of Indore, 11 years ago, on April 15, India defeated England in the first match under Rahul Dravid’s captaincy. Interestingly, many Indian players who were struggling with their bad form, this stadium has provided sanjivani. From this ground, there are many memories of Virat Kohli, Mahendra Singh Dhoni and former cricketer Rahul Dravid and Virender Sehwag. Team India captain Virat Kohli was going through a bad phase at a time-tested Test. His average was 18.85 in 7 innings. But on the same ground, he did not only win the Indian team by playing 211 runs but also returned to the form.
In this stadium, former Taufani opener Virender Sehwag scored his best ODI score. He gave the victory of his team by playing blistering innings of 219 runs against the West Indies. Earlier, Sehwag was also craving for runs. Sehwag had made the highest score of one-day history as a result of this innings. He broke the record of Sachin Tendulkar’s 200 runs in cricket.
